Ubuntu16.04系统搭建web环境apache2-mysql-php7-阿里云开发者社区

开发者社区> 数据库> 正文

Ubuntu16.04系统搭建web环境apache2-mysql-php7

简介:

0x00 安装Apache2

1
sudo apt-get install apache2

0x01 安装PHP

1
2
sudo apt-get install php
sudo apt-get install libapache2-mod-php

0x02 安装MySql

1
2
3
4
5
sudo apt-get install mysql-server    (安装中会提示设置数据库root的密码)
sudo apt-get install mysql-client
mysql_secure_installation            (输入数据库root的密码,没有什么特殊需要的全部回车就可以了)
#mysql_secure_installation执行出错的话,可以启动下mysql服务
#sudo service mysql start

0x03 安装PHP一些必要插件

1
sudo apt-get install php-mysql php-gd php-imap php-ldap php-mbstring php-odbc php-pear php-xml php-xmlrpc

0x04 测试

1
2
3
4
5
6
7
8
9
10
11
12
进入网站根目录 #cd /var/www/html
编辑测试文件   #vim test.php   (vim Ubuntu16.04貌似需要安装 sudo apt-get install vim)
<?php
echo "Hello World!"
?>
在编辑时可能出现的问题:vim不能写入文件,是因为html是root-root且权限是755其他用户没有写入权限
#sudo chmod 777 html
1.先测试PHP编译
#php test.php
2.测试Apache解析
#curl 127.0.0.1/test.php
返回 Hello World! 则安装成功。




本文转自 nw01f 51CTO博客,原文链接:http://blog.51cto.com/dearch/1831036,如需转载请自行联系原作者

版权声明:本文首发在云栖社区,遵循云栖社区版权声明:本文内容由互联网用户自发贡献,版权归用户作者所有,云栖社区不为本文内容承担相关法律责任。云栖社区已升级为阿里云开发者社区。如果您发现本文中有涉嫌抄袭的内容,欢迎发送邮件至:developer2020@service.aliyun.com 进行举报,并提供相关证据,一经查实,阿里云开发者社区将协助删除涉嫌侵权内容。

分享:
数据库
使用钉钉扫一扫加入圈子
+ 订阅

分享数据库前沿,解构实战干货,推动数据库技术变革

其他文章